docker-compose 的安装与使用
1. docker-compose 安装, 因为由python 编写,所以可以用pip 安装。
sudo pip install -U docker-compose==1.7.0
2. 编写一个docker-compose.yml 文件。以下为3个docker 容器。分别为web, mysql, redis.
web: build: . ports: - "8000:8000" links: - mysql:mysql - redis:redis env_file: .env volume: . /code command: /code/manage.py runserver 0.0.0.0:8000 mysql: image: daocloud.io/mysql:latest environment: - MYSQL_DATABASE=django - MYSQL_ROOT_PASSWORD=mysql ports: - "3306:3306" redis: image: daocloud.io/redis:latest ports: - "6379:6379"
3. build 容器组
docker-compose build
4. 启动容器组:
docker-compose up